Professional training, networking and a new record: the 13th Leipzig Veterinary Congress (Germany) attracted 7,400 veterinarians, veterinary assistants and students. 580 speakers shared the latest findings from science, research and practice. At the same time, 352 exhibitors from 20 countries presented their products, services and technologies for everyday veterinary practice at the sold-out Vetexpo Europe.
Martin Buhl-Wagner, Managing Director of Leipziger Messe, explains: ‘The Leipzig Veterinary Congress thrives on the interplay between scientific discourse and practical innovation. Vetexpo Europe has made this connection visible – as a place where research, industry and practice come together. The fact that the event has grown once again and gained international appeal encourages us to further expand Leipzig as a leading location for animal health.’
The 14th Leipzig Veterinary Congress will take place from 20 to 22 January 2028, concurrently with Partner Pferd at the Leipzig Trade Fair.
